SoC is a parameter representing the amount of remaining electrical charge in the battery cell, which depends on many factors such as current, voltage, temperature, and especially the degree of aging of the battery cell. With the same SoC level, a new battery cell will allow the vehicle to travel a longer distance than an old battery cell.

How Do You Calculate Battery Backup Hours Using a Formula? To calculate battery backup hours, use the formula: Backup Hours = (Battery Capacity in Ah × Battery Voltage) / (Load in Watts). This formula helps determine how long a battery will support a specific electrical load. Battery Capacity: Battery capacity is measured in ampere-hours (Ah).

The estimation of battery SOH can be divided into two categories. One is based on battery model methods, which require calibration of battery model parameters to achieve battery SOH estimation, usually combined with SOC estimation. 1. Age and Condition. Old car batteries in good condition tend to fetch a higher price than those that are damaged or deteriorated.; The age of the battery also plays a role in its worth, with newer batteries typically being more valuable.; 2. Market Demand. The current demand for recycled materials, such as lead and plastic, impacts the worth of old car batteries.

Battery performances vary with battery temperature, discharge/charge current and health state. To further improve the accuracy of SOC estimation, battery model parameters are identified by the recursive least squares (RLS) algorithm in real-time to reflect such variation.
